2023年职业考证-软考-数据库系统工程师考试冲刺押题易错题集AB卷(含答案)试题号:81.docxVIP

  • 0
  • 0
  • 约3.39千字
  • 约 6页
  • 2026-03-16 发布于山西
  • 举报

2023年职业考证-软考-数据库系统工程师考试冲刺押题易错题集AB卷(含答案)试题号:81.docx

2023年职业考证-软考-数据库系统工程师考试冲刺押题易错题集AB卷(含答案)试题号:81

考试时间:______分钟总分:______分姓名:______

一、单项选择题(下列选项中,只有一项符合题意)

1.在关系模型中,若属性A能决定关系R中所有其他属性,则属性A称为关系R的()。

A.候选键

B.主键

C.外键

D.超键

2.已知关系R(A,B,C)和关系S(B,C,D),其中R和S具有相同的属性B和C。关系T=RS的结果中包含R和S的元组,这种连接操作称为()。

A.内连接

B.左外连接

C.右外连接

D.全外连接

3.SQL语句中,用于删除表中的数据的命令是()。

A.DELETE

B.REMOVE

C.ERASE

D.DROP

4.在SQL查询中,使用`GROUPBY`子句的目的是()。

A.对查询结果进行排序

B.限制查询返回的记录数

C.对查询结果进行分组,并对其中的数据项进行聚合

D.连接多个表

5.下列关于数据库事务的ACID特性的说法中,错误的是()。

A.原子性(Atomicity):事务中的所有操作要么全部完成,要么全部不做

B.一致性(Consistency):事务必须使数据库从一个一致性状态转变到另一个一致性状态

C.隔离性(Isolation):一个事务的执行不能被其他事务干扰

D.持久性(Durability):一个事务一旦提交,它对数据库中数据的改变就是永久性的,即使系统发生故障也不会丢失

6.在数据库并发控制中,读未提交(ReadUncommitted)隔离级别可能会出现的问题是()。

A.脏读

B.不可重复读

C.幻读

D.以上都是

7.数据库的规范化理论主要是为了解决数据库设计中出现的()问题。

A.数据冗余

B.数据独立性

C.数据安全性

D.数据完整性

8.在关系数据库设计中,将一个关系模式分解为多个关系模式,目的是为了()。

A.增加数据表的个数

B.减少数据冗余

C.提高查询速度

D.增加数据表之间的联系

9.下列关于视图的描述中,错误的是()。

A.视图是一个虚表,它存储在数据库中

B.视图可以是基于一个或多个基本表创建的

C.视图可以简化复杂的查询操作

D.视图可以用来实现数据库的逻辑数据独立性

10.在SQL中,使用`CREATEINDEX`语句的作用是()。

A.创建一个新表

B.删除一个表

C.在表中创建一个索引,以加快查询速度

D.修改表的结构

二、简答题

1.简述数据库三级模式结构的含义及其优点。

2.解释数据库中的“脏读”、“不可重复读”和“幻读”三种现象,并说明它们分别发生在哪种隔离级别或更高隔离级别下。

3.什么是数据库的规范化?简述第一范式(1NF)、第二范式(2NF)和第三范式(3NF)的主要要求。

三、SQL题

1.假设有两个数据库表:学生表(Student,包含字段:StudentID,StudentName,ClassID),班级表(Class,包含字段:ClassID,ClassName,TeacherName)。请编写一个SQL查询语句,查找所有班主任姓名为“张三”的班级中所有学生的姓名。

2.假设有订单表(Order,包含字段:OrderID,OrderDate,CustomerID,Amount),其中Amount表示订单金额。请编写一个SQL查询语句,查询2023年1月1日之后产生的订单中,订单金额大于2000元的订单数量。

3.假设有员工表(Employee,包含字段:EmployeeID,EmployeeName,DepartmentID,Salary),其中DepartmentID是部门编号。请编写一个SQL查询语句,查询每个部门的平均工资,并要求结果按平均工资从高到低排序。

四、设计题

1.设计一个简单的学生选课系统数据库逻辑结构。需要包含至少三个表:学生表、课程表、选课表。请说明每个表的主要字段及其数据类型(例如:学生表至少包含学号、姓名、性别等字段),并说明表与表之间的联系(如通过哪些字段关联)。

五、论述题

1.论述数据库事务的隔离性和持久性在保证数据库可靠性和数据一致性方面的重要性。

试卷答案

一、单项选择题

文档评论(0)

1亿VIP精品文档

相关文档